我有一个web应用程序,可以在Windows上运行我的Tomcat6(本地)。我有一个独立的服务器,安装在Tomcat6上,Ubuntu安装在服务器上。现在,如果我尝试输入我的webapps http:{ipaddress}{ web -app},浏览器会打开标题网页。然后出现用于输入日志名和密码的对话框窗口。但在按下登录按钮时,浏览器Chrome显示访问servlet {servletname}服务器返回状态代码:500 Internal server Error。如何配置互联网的tomcat6?我认为catalina不会从servlet返回外部请求的应答。我想使用tomcat6作为独立服务
我在高级模式下使用Prime faces文件上传,它在本地系统中工作良好,但在UAT中,侦听器不是called.why?我尝试了许多建议,仍然是同样的问题exists.please帮助我。
UAT(Linux)我使用的是tomee服务器Local(Windows) tomcat服务器primefaces 5.3
enter code here
我无法在Linux上启动或停止Tomcat。由于服务器是新的,而且我们第一次运行它,shutdown.sh抛出一个异常,尽管我已经放置了log4j.properties:
/tomcat/V6.0/bin$ ./shutdown.sh
After calling setenv.sh: Using JAVA_HOME:
After calling setenv.sh: Using JRE_HOME: /usr/java/jdk1.8.0_91/jre
After cygwin: Using JAVA_HOME:
After cygwin: Using JR
我有Spring应用程序,在我的JSP中我有一个表单,它将文件上传到本地Tomcat目录“C:/apache-tomcat-7.0.56/照片”。
下面是我的Tomcat文件结构:
C:\
apache-tomcat-7.0.56\
bin\
conf\
lib\
logs\
photos\ <-- I WANT TO READ FILES FROM THAT FOLDER
photo1.jpg
photo2.jpg
temp\
webapps\
myapp\ <-- MY S
我已经在linux上安装了java和tomcat appache服务器。当我打算在linux服务器上使用./startup.sh命令启动tomcat时,它给出的输出为
Using CATALINA_BASE: /usr/src/apache-tomcat-5.5.28
Using CATALINA_HOME: /usr/src/apache-tomcat-5.5.28
Using CATALINA_TMPDIR: /usr/src/apache-tomcat-5.5.28/temp
Using JRE_HOME: /usr/src/jdk1.6.0_16
Using CL
首先,很抱歉我的英语很差,请理解我)我想知道tomcat for windows pc和Linux服务器之间的转换有一些不同的行为。我的意思是,浏览器请求的头名称在我的pc上的tomcat中被转换为小写,但Linux服务器的tomcat与相同的网页不同。
服务器应用程序检查从浏览器接收的头部名称是否等于服务器的密钥,该密钥已经被转换为从配置文件读取的小写字母。
因此,当两个密钥都与windows pc匹配(小写)时,它工作得很好,但Linux服务器不匹配(从浏览器收到的报头不转换为小写)。
请谁来解释一下为什么会这样。
谢谢。
本地PC : Tomcat服务器: Red Hat Linux E